The brief

The Authority is seeking to work with commercial partner(s) to provide reintegration services for people returning from the UK to their countries of origin.

The Authority aims to support a range of returnees (voluntary or enforced) from across the immigration system, potentially including Foreign National Offenders (FNOs).

Initially, the countries in scope for this service are: Afghanistan, Albania, Algeria, Bangladesh, China, Eritrea, Ethiopia, Ghana, India, Iraq, Iran, Jamaica, Morocco, Nigeria, Pakistan, Sudan, Tunisia, Turkey, Ukraine, Vietnam and Zimbabwe.

The Authority is exploring the method in which this service may be delivered.

The current intention (which is not guaranteed) is for this service to be disaggregated, with separate contracts for each lot, possibly split by geographical area.

Please see an indicative example below: Africa: Eritrea, Ethiopia, Sudan, Zimbabwe, Nigeria, Tunisia, Algeria, Morocco, Ghana Middle East: Afghanistan, Iraq, Iran Europe: Ukraine, Albania & Turkey Caribbean: Jamaica Asia: India, Pakistan, Bangladesh, Vietnam, China The Authority is exploring the type and method in which support will be delivered to returnees, but the service provider may be expected to provide: 1.

Remote provision of information pre-departure from the UK; 2.

Assistance on arrival, that could include: • Airport pick-up; • Arrival assistance and immediate necessities; • Onward travel assistance in-country; • Emergency/ short-term housing; • Immediate medical support.

3.

Cash support and reintegration counselling, that could include: • Periodic face-to-face reintegration counselling combined with cash distribution - at least three times over a six-month period; • Availability by phone to provide information/ assistance on ad-hoc basis; including; advice on accessing schooling or further education; advice on accessing vocational training; advice on finding employment; family tracing; legal support.

4.

Reintegration Assistance • Coaching; • Co-designing a reintegration plan with the returnee that may include using available funds to: - Set up an individual or collective small business with other returnees/ integrating the returnee into an existing or new community income generating activity; - Paid academic or vocational training; - An apprenticeship; - Contribute to living costs while pursuing any of the above options.

There is also an ambition to use the service for a small number of selected voluntary returnees, within Albania and India, that also support the wider community.

This is something that the Authority would like to explore with the market.

In other developing countries worldwide, the Authority is considering the possibility of providing: 1.

Verification of the arrival of the returnee (face to face or remotely) to trigger cash disbursement 2.

Further telephone only provision of information/assistance on ad-hoc basis
